Kernel: Lock the inode before writing in SharedInodeVMObject::sync

We ensure that when we call SharedInodeVMObject::sync we lock the inode
lock before calling Inode virtual write_bytes method directly to avoid
assertion on the unlocked inode lock, as it was regressed recently. This
is not a complete fix as the need to lock from each path before calling
the write_bytes method should be avoided because it can lead to
hard-to-find bugs, and this commit only fixes the problem temporarily.
